A RESOLUTION O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F THE
COLONY, TEXAS, APPROVING THE TERMS AND CONDITIONS OF A
CONTRACT AMENDMENT NO. 7 BY AND BETWEEN THE CITY OF
THE COLONY AND AUSTIN BRIDGE & ROAD, L.P. FOR THE
NORTHERN TRAFFIC SIGNAL POLE, FOUNDATION, AND CONDUIT,
UNDERGROUND WATER MEDIATION, AND OTHER ADDITIONAL
WORK FOR PHASE 1 OF THE SOUTH COLONY BOULEVARD GRADE
SEPARATION AT S.H. 121, INCORPORATED HEREIN AS EXHIBIT
"A"; AUTHORIZING THE CITY MANAGER TO EXECUTE THE
CONTRACT AMENDMENT; PROVIDING AN EFFECTIVE DATE
WHEREAS, the City and Consultant have entered into an agreement such that the
Consultant is to provide the following services: the northern traffic signal pole, foundation, and
conduit, underground water mediation, and other additional work; and
WHEREAS, the City has determined that it is in the best interest of the City to enter into
the Contract Amendment No. 7 with AUSTIN BRIDGE & ROAD, L.P. which is attached
hereto and incorporated herein by reference as Exhibit "A," under the terms and conditions
provided therein.
WHEREAS, with this Contract Amendment the City of The Colony is agreeing to pay
the sum not to exceed $207,068.37 for such work, with funding available through TIRZ No. 1,
NCTCOG/RTR, and city right-of-way acquisition.
TH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F
THE COLONY, TEXAS THAT:
Section 1. The Contract Amendment, which is attached and incorporated hereto as Exhibit
"A", having been reviewed by the City Council of the City of The Colony, Texas, and found to be
acceptable and in the best interest of the City and its citizens, be, and the same is hereby, in all
things approved in the amount of$207,068.37 and the City Manager is hereby authorized to execute
the Contract Amendment on behalf of the City of The Colony, Texas.
Section 2. That this Resolution shall take effect immediately from and after its adoption
and it is so resolved.
PASSED, APPROVED and EFFECTIVE this 2' day of JUNE, 2015.
